浙江省 建德市市场监管局食品安全监督抽检信息通告(2026年第1期)
Xin Lang Cai Jing· 2026-02-14 09:16
Core Viewpoint - The recent food safety inspection in Jiande City revealed that out of 68 food samples tested, 67 passed while 1 failed due to excessive aluminum residue, highlighting ongoing concerns regarding food safety standards in the region [2] Group 1: Inspection Results - Jiande City Market Supervision Administration conducted a sampling inspection of 68 food samples across 18 categories, including grain products, catering foods, pastries, meat products, condiments, and bean products [2] - Only 1 sample, specifically oil tofu produced by Yongxiang Bean Products Workshop in Hangtou Town, was found to be non-compliant with national food safety standards due to aluminum residue [2] Group 2: Non-compliance Details - The non-compliance issue was related to aluminum residue levels, which exceeded the national safety standard limit of ≤100 mg/kg for bean products [2] - The presence of aluminum in food additives, such as potassium aluminum sulfate and ammonium aluminum sulfate, is permissible when used according to standards; however, excessive intake may pose health risks, particularly to children [2] Group 3: Regulatory Actions - The Jiande City Market Supervision Administration has referred the non-compliant product and its producing enterprise to the relevant local market supervision departments for further action in accordance with the Food Safety Law of the People's Republic of China [2]

浙江省市场监管局4月和5月食品安全监督抽检结果显示 豆制品不合格项目主要涉及食品添加剂超范围超限量使用
Zhong Guo Zhi Liang Xin Wen Wang· 2025-05-20 04:42
Core Viewpoint - The Zhejiang Provincial Market Supervision Administration has identified non-compliance issues in soy products primarily related to the excessive use of food additives, highlighting the need for stricter enforcement of food safety standards [1][2][3]. Group 1: Inspection Results - In April and May, the Zhejiang Provincial Market Supervision Administration conducted eight rounds of food safety inspections focused on soy products [1]. - Specific non-compliance cases included three batches of soy products failing to meet safety standards due to the presence of lemon yellow, a synthetic coloring agent [2]. - Other violations included the detection of benzoic acid and its sodium salt, as well as aluminum residue exceeding the national safety standards in various soy products [2][3]. Group 2: Regulatory Standards - The use of lemon yellow in dried vegetables and soy products is prohibited under the national food safety standards (GB 2760-2014) [3][4]. - Benzoic acid and its sodium salt are also banned in soy products, as their excessive consumption can lead to liver toxicity [4]. - The maximum allowable limit for aluminum residue in soy products is set at 100 mg/kg, according to the updated standards (GB 2760-2024) [5]. Group 3: Potential Causes of Non-compliance - The excessive use of lemon yellow may stem from manufacturers attempting to enhance product appearance and market value [4]. - The presence of benzoic acid could be due to efforts to extend shelf life or compensate for poor hygiene during production [4]. - Aluminum residue issues may arise from improper control of aluminum-containing additives or high aluminum content in raw materials [5].
